> 100% pure SeaHash does x ^= t at the start first, instead of `t ^ (t << 1)` 
> on the RHS.

Indeed. Some initial testing shows that this kind of "input mangling" (applying 
such a permutation on the inputs) actually plays a much more important role to 
avoid collisions than the SeaHash operation x ^= ((x >> 16) >> (x >> 29)).

So my suggestion remains

for y in INPUT:
    t = hash(y)
    t ^= t * SOME_LARGE_EVEN_NUMBER
    h ^= t
    h *= MULTIPLIER

Adding in the additional SeaHash operations

    x ^= ((x >> 16) >> (x >> 29))
    x *= MULTIPLIER

does not increase the probability of the tests passing.
